About this listen

What is brand, and how are brands built?

Brand Warfare offers unconventional answers to these questions. Julian Kynaston's no-holds-barred, fast-paced account of how he launched and grew Propaganda into one of the UK's most successful brand consultancies provides inspirational insights into the emergence of a unique brand talent.

From running with a notorious firm of football casuals to sitting on the board of global brands as a key consultant, Julian learned how to succeed without even pitching in an environment where many other brand agencies fail. His journey illustrates that having the courage to push against assumptions can deliver significant growth and commercial success for client after client.
